Ming Huang is a scholar working on Molecular Biology, Artificial Intelligence and General Health Professions. According to data from OpenAlex, Ming Huang has authored 57 papers receiving a total of 645 ind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Molecular Biology, 19 papers in Artificial Intelligence and 11 papers in General Health Professions. Recurrent topics in Ming Huang’s work include Health Literacy and Information Accessibility (8 papers), Machine Learning in Healthcare (8 papers) and Mental Health via Writing (7 papers). Ming Huang is often cited by papers focused on Health Literacy and Information Accessibility (8 papers), Machine Learning in Healthcare (8 papers) and Mental Health via Writing (7 papers). Ming Huang collaborates with scholars based in United States, China and Hong Kong. Ming Huang's co-authors include Darrin M. York, Timothy J. Giese, Tai‐Sung Lee, Haoyuan Chen, Lixia Yao, Brian K. Radak, K. Y. Wong, Andrew Wen, Nansu Zong and Maryam Zolnoori and has published in prestigious journals such as Journal of Clinical Oncology, Accounts of Chemical Research and Physical Chemistry Chemical Physics.
